Patakie from the Ogbe Fun sign:

Guess in Heaven for two monkey brothers.

During his stay in Heaven, he performed major divination ceremonies. He guessed for two monkey brothers (from the monkey family named Edun and Ariwo). He told her to sacrifice and stop arguing so they could avoid sudden death. Edon made the sacrifice but Ariwo refused to do so. However, they did not refrain from continuing their constant bickering and arguing.

One day, the two brothers were arguing over a fruit, when they were on top of a tree. The discussion that broke out between them attracted the hunter, who took advantage and shot him. Ariwo fell wounded and died. Edon ran away.

Therefore, in divination the person should be told to serve ESHU with a male goat and to refrain from being poisoned until death.

It is believed that Ariwo would not have died if he had not had his altercation with Edon.

Guess for cough and throat.

His surrogates Baba Kou Kou and Baba kan Gidi Kan Gidi guessed for cough and throat when they left Heaven. They advised the cough to make sacrifices so that it could have abode on Earth. They told him to sacrifice kola nut, coconut and a small chicken to ESHU. He made the sacrifice.

They also advised the throat to sacrifice to ESHU with goat, palm oil, honey and salt, in order to avoid on Earth the risk of harboring a parasitic and troublesome host. He refused to make the sacrifice. They both came to the World separately. Upon arrival, Latos began to look for a home.

She approached the throat for temporary accommodation and the latter agreed to grant it.

The throat began to be interested in the materials used by the cough to make sacrifice in Heaven, which was kola nut and coconut. As the throat ate these materials more and more, the cough began to develop at home. The three materials with which the throat refused to make the sacrifice in Heaven, are the antidotes that would have prevented the cough from developing rapidly, but he refused to use them.

As the cough developed, his throat became so sick that his voice became inaudible.

Then the throat went to ORUNMILA by divination, where he told him that he himself was the architect of his misfortune, by refusing to make a sacrifice as he had been told to do in Heaven.

However, ORUNMILA advised him to do it with two goats, honey, palm oil, roasted coconut and roasted kolá nut. He produced the necessary materials quickly. After the sacrifice, ORUNMILA took part of the materials, added burned marble seeds (akue in Benin), roasted kolá nut, burned them and mixed the powder with salt, palm oil, honey and gave the mixture to the throat to to lick from time to time.

As the materials used to prepare the mixture were the same as those forbidden to coughs, the cough ran and entered the stomach house seeking shelter as soon as the throat began to lick the medicine. It was only from that moment that the throat began to have peace of mind.

In fortune-telling if Ogbe Fun comes out, the person should be told to make sacrifice to ESHU and to refrain from hosting any visitor for some time, so as to avoid the danger of hosting someone who will create serious problems for him, such as insomnia or wakefulness. He should refrain from eating kola nuts and coconuts.

DIFFICULTY IN MARRIAGE

Ogbe Fun Funlo story

There was a girl who had difficulty not finding relationships and when they met they told each other what their bad luck would be, because they could not find boyfriends, and they were already passing the time for marriage. They went to parties and meetings, but they never found boyfriends. Olofin's daughter was among them and in the same conditions.

One day Olofin organized a party and invited all the girls and before going to the party they went to Orúnmìlà's house, who made him bear seeing this ifá telling him that they had difficulty finding boyfriends to get married, and to solve this problem they had to do ebo. They all went to the party that Olofin gave, after having made ebo. Òrúnmìlà told them that they were all going to get married

There were six young guests, all of them found their respective ones, but this did not happen to Olofin's daughter, so seeing this, that the others had married and that her daughter had remained single, she wanted to know the cause and why. He went to Òrúnmìlà's house and he told him that his daughter had not married and the others had, so Olofin gave him his daughter's hand and ìrúnmìlà married.
